Get the job you really want.

Top Software Engineer Jobs in Malaysia

9 Days Ago
Petaling Jaya, Petaling, Selangor, MYS
166,834 Employees
Mid level
166,834 Employees
Mid level
Internet of Things
The role involves developing algorithms for embedded software, contributing to technical implementations, and addressing SW engineering tasks. Responsibilities include quality assurance, investigating technical issues, collaborating with teams, and mentoring less experienced colleagues.
9 Days Ago
Bayan Lepas, Barat Daya, Pulau Pinang, MYS
166,834 Employees
Mid level
166,834 Employees
Mid level
Internet of Things
The Embedded Software Engineer will develop embedded firmware for Bosch products, ensuring interaction with manufacturing test systems, collaborating with teams in Malaysia and Germany, and adhering to Bosch's software engineering processes. Responsibilities include software design, integration, testing, and documentation.
9 Days Ago
Bayan Lepas, Barat Daya, Pulau Pinang, MYS
166,834 Employees
Mid level
166,834 Employees
Mid level
Internet of Things
The Staff/Senior Engineer will develop algorithms and contribute to technical concepts in embedded software, collaborate with team members, ensure deliverable quality, and support less experienced colleagues, while communicating with internal stakeholders.
9 Days Ago
Petaling Jaya, Petaling, Selangor, MYS
25,132 Employees
Junior
25,132 Employees
Junior
Big Data • Cloud • Hardware • Software
The Senior Engineer will design, develop, test, and maintain firmware for electronic hard disk drives (eHDD), utilizing C++ and Python. Responsibilities include collaborating in Agile processes, solving complex hardware and software problems, and creating design documents. Experience in embedded systems and related interfaces is essential, with a focus on delivering innovative storage solutions.
9 Days Ago
Batu Kawan, Selatan, Pulau Pinang, MYS
25,132 Employees
Senior level
25,132 Employees
Senior level
Big Data • Cloud • Hardware • Software
Lead the design, development, and deployment of complex data systems and pipelines, ensuring data quality and security. Collaborate with teams to integrate data solutions, implement processing frameworks, and develop strategies for data storage and retrieval. Stay updated on industry trends to drive innovation.
9 Days Ago
Petaling Jaya, Petaling, Selangor, MYS
25,132 Employees
Junior
25,132 Employees
Junior
Big Data • Cloud • Hardware • Software
Develop and maintain test scripts in Python for validating firmware and hardware features. Collaborate with various teams to improve firmware quality and customize testing suites. Participate in Agile processes to efficiently deliver storage products with specific interfaces.
10 Days Ago
Petaling Jaya, Petaling, Selangor, MYS
10,000 Employees
Senior level
10,000 Employees
Senior level
Food • Transportation • Financial Services
As a Senior Software Engineer at Grab, you will design, implement, and maintain applications focusing on both front-end and back-end development. Responsibilities include building scalable backend systems, writing high-quality code, developing React applications for data visualization, and collaborating with multiple stakeholders to enhance software development processes.
11 Days Ago
Kulim, Kedah, MYS
23,282 Employees
Mid level
23,282 Employees
Mid level
Semiconductor
The Software Application Engineer is responsible for software analysis, design, development, testing, and documentation. They collaborate on project timelines and specifications, ensuring technical outcomes meet requirements. This role involves enhancing and supporting application functionality and may include regional travel for customer support.
11 Days Ago
Kulim, Kedah, MYS
23,282 Employees
Mid level
23,282 Employees
Mid level
Semiconductor
The Software Application Engineer will develop, analyze, and enhance software applications, participate in project planning, and ensure that engineering solutions meet customer and technical requirements. The role requires extensive experience in software development and familiarity with SDLC concepts, as well as strong communication skills.
12 Days Ago
Malaysia
10,936 Employees
1-1 Annually
Mid level
10,936 Employees
1-1 Annually
Mid level
AdTech • Digital Media • Marketing Tech
The Senior Software Engineer will design and develop scalable backend solutions, collaborate with teams to define requirements, and optimize data pipelines. Responsibilities include working on APIs, implementing SOA architectures, and collaborating with third-party vendors throughout the development lifecycle.
13 Days Ago
Kuala Lumpur, Wilayah Persekutuan Kuala Lumpur, MYS
2,922 Employees
Senior level
2,922 Employees
Senior level
Marketing Tech
The Senior Software Engineer at SEEK will develop platforms for data scientists and engineers, working with AI/ML services to identify job candidates. Responsibilities include software development, system maintenance, and ensuring platform reliability.
14 Days Ago
Petaling Jaya, Petaling, Selangor, MYS
10,000 Employees
Mid level
10,000 Employees
Mid level
Food • Transportation • Financial Services
Develop high-quality iOS applications while collaborating with teams to identify project requirements. Responsibilities include creating technical documentation, troubleshooting complex issues, and applying knowledge of the latest iOS development trends to enhance product quality.
20 Days Ago
Malaysia
309 Employees
Expert/Leader
309 Employees
Expert/Leader
Software
As a Staff Software Engineer, you will design, develop, and maintain software solutions according to specifications while ensuring adherence to quality standards. You will provide technical leadership, collaborate with cross-functional teams, perform code reviews, and estimate work efforts. Additionally, you will lead initiatives to improve development processes and guide team members.
18 Days Ago
Kulim, Kedah, MYS
23,282 Employees
Junior
23,282 Employees
Junior
Semiconductor
The Software Application Engineer will assist customers during the pre-sales process, providing application and technical support. This role involves software and algorithm application, product installation support, demo preparation, and post-sale strategy development. The candidate should have knowledge of factory automation software and experience with operating systems like Windows, Unix, and Linux.
18 Days Ago
Kulim, Kedah, MYS
23,282 Employees
Mid level
23,282 Employees
Mid level
Semiconductor
The Software Application Engineer creates, plans, and performs software analysis, design, development, and testing tasks. This role focuses on enhancing project functionality by applying SDLC concepts, developing applications using various technologies including C++ and Python, and ensuring compliance with engineering practices. The engineer will also support product rollouts globally and provide informal guidance to new team members.
18 Days Ago
Kulim, Kedah, MYS
23,282 Employees
Mid level
23,282 Employees
Mid level
Semiconductor
As a Software Application Engineer (QA), you will test the SmartFactory® MES solution, develop test plans, report defects, perform regression tests, and provide feedback during design reviews. You'll also communicate test results, guide new team members informally, and stay updated on testing best practices.
19 Days Ago
Malaysia
10,936 Employees
Senior level
10,936 Employees
Senior level
AdTech • Digital Media • Marketing Tech
The Senior Software Engineer at Kinesso will develop and optimize data pipelines, create highly scalable backend solutions, and collaborate with various teams to implement service-oriented architectures. Responsibilities include working with product owners on requirements, engaging with third-party vendors, and ensuring high-quality software delivery.
19 Days Ago
Taman Teknologi Malaysia, Petaling, Kuala Lumpur, Wilayah Persekutuan Kuala Lumpur, MYS
1,461 Employees
Senior level
1,461 Employees
Senior level
Retail • Software
As a Senior Software Developer specializing in Java, responsible for designing, building, and maintaining efficient and reliable code, collaborating with SCRUM teams, and ensuring high-performance applications. Must have 10+ years of hands-on experience in Java, Spring framework, API design, testing, and database skills. Preferable skills include strong customer orientation, effective communication, and the ability to work independently and with teams in a multicultural environment.
19 Days Ago
Taman Teknologi Malaysia, Petaling, Kuala Lumpur, Wilayah Persekutuan Kuala Lumpur, MYS
1,461 Employees
Senior level
1,461 Employees
Senior level
Retail • Software
Design, build, and maintain efficient, reusable, and reliable Java code. Ensure best performance and quality of applications. Identify and solve bugs and bottlenecks. Mentor junior developers. Collaborate with team members and stakeholders.
23 Days Ago
Petaling Jaya, Petaling, Selangor, MYS
10,000 Employees
Mid level
10,000 Employees
Mid level
Food • Transportation • Financial Services
As a Senior Software Engineer, you will collaborate with Engineers, UI Designers, and Data teams to enhance automation and operational efficiency at Grab. Your responsibilities include designing and coding in Go and Python, improving service availability and scalability, conducting code reviews, and supporting the debugging of complex software.
22 Days Ago
Petaling Jaya, Petaling, Selangor, MYS
10,000 Employees
Mid level
10,000 Employees
Mid level
Food • Transportation • Financial Services
The Senior Software Engineer will enhance Grab's distributed search platform for food and mart channels, collaborating with product teams on requirement analysis, conducting code reviews, debugging, and developing search strategies. They will also resolve production issues to minimize user impact.
22 Days Ago
Petaling Jaya, Petaling, Selangor, MYS
10,000 Employees
Senior level
10,000 Employees
Senior level
Food • Transportation • Financial Services
The Senior Software Engineer will work with product and design teams to develop scalable backend solutions, conduct technical discussions, write high-quality reusable code, and improve existing codebases. They will also provide mentorship and handle production issues, ensuring seamless operations for millions of users.
22 Days Ago
Petaling Jaya, Petaling, Selangor, MYS
10,000 Employees
Mid level
10,000 Employees
Mid level
Food • Transportation • Financial Services
As a Senior Software Engineer (Backend), you will collaborate with product and design teams to develop scalable services, participate in technical discussions, ensure product quality, improve codebases, and mentor peers. Your expertise in backend development and cloud technologies will be essential as you build solutions for millions of users in Southeast Asia.
23 Days Ago
Petaling Jaya, Petaling, Selangor, MYS
10,000 Employees
Senior level
10,000 Employees
Senior level
Food • Transportation • Financial Services
As a Senior Backend Engineer on the Mobility Team at Grab, you will design and implement services using Go to enhance the efficiency and scalability of Grab's ride-hailing module. You will collaborate with engineers, participate in service planning, and mentor peers while ensuring high coding standards and resolving production incidents.
23 Days Ago
Petaling Jaya, Petaling, Selangor, MYS
10,000 Employees
Mid level
10,000 Employees
Mid level
Food • Transportation • Financial Services
As a Senior Fullstack Engineer at Grab, you will develop robust backend services using Golang and user-friendly front components using ReactJS. You'll collaborate with cross-functional teams, participate in the software development lifecycle, and ensure best practices through code reviews and performance optimizations.
All Filters
Date Posted
Job Category
Experience
Industry
Company Name
Company Size